The journey into the realm of biochemistry was not a random choice but a path carved out of personal interest and tragedy. The early years as a nuclear scientist at Argonne National Laboratory sparked an interest in the biochemical basis of behavior. This interest was further fueled by a personal tragedy - the suicide of a close family member. This unfortunate event led to a quest to understand the biochemical factors that could lead to such extreme mental health issues. The subsequent research at the Pfeiffer Treatment Center was a significant milestone in this journey. Studying more than 30,000 patients with mental disorders provided a wealth of knowledge and insights into the biochemical underpinnings of these conditions. One of the most striking cases was that of a young man with violent tendencies whose behavior improved dramatically after biochemical intervention. This case further underscored the potential of biochemical treatments in managing mental health disorders. The establishment of the Walsh Research Institute in 2008 marked a new chapter in this journey. The institute has not only continued the research but has also trained doctors and medical practitioners in advanced nutrient therapy techniques. The impact of this work has been significant, with over 500 doctors from various countries receiving training. This has led to a broader understanding and acceptance of biochemical treatments in the medical community. About William J. Walsh
William J. Walsh is a renowned scientist and doctor of biochemistry who specializes in nutritional medicine. He has conducted extensive research in the field of mental health and has developed nutrient-based therapies to treat biochemical imbalances, contributing significantly to the field of integrative medicine.
